Agenda: (Informal statements and proposals) -- (President's report): A. Kansas Board of Regents Statement on Faculty Evaluation -- (Old business): A. Proposal revisions to the Subvention policy from Faculty Support Committee / Jeff Quirin -- (New business): A. Roberts Rules of Order/Faculty Senate Rules / Will Klunder
Attachments: Proposed revisions of Subvention section of Handbook for Faculty -- Tuition Assistance Donation Guide -- Faculty Senate Rules -- Robert's Rules of Order -- Amend Policy Manual to Include a Statement on Teaching Evaluation
Minutes: (Informal statements and proposals): Questions about Tasers being used on WSU Campus and Disability Services request forms / Senator P. Moore-Jansen -- President of SGA mentioned issues SGA is considering including X/F grading, 10 hours pass/fail credit independent of degree requirements, sign-language satisfying language requirements, and +/- grading -- Donations to faculty tuition assistance program / President Carruthers -- SU has been fully accredited for another ten years / Provost Miller -- Stressed the importance of having policies in place before academic freedom issues come up / Senator Gordon -- (Old business): A. Roberts Rules of Order / Faculty Senate Rules / Senator Klunder -- (New business): A. Proposed revision to the Subvention Policy / Jeff Quirin -- (President's report): A.
